A version of the Serenity prayer appearing on an Alcoholics Anonymous medallion (date unknown).. The Serenity Prayer is an invocation by the petitioner for wisdom to understand the difference between circumstances ("things") that can and cannot be changed, asking courage to take action in the case of the former, and serenity to accept in the case of the latter.

Wassane Sihinaya or theatrically Senehasaka Sihinaya, (Sinhala: වස්සානේ සිහිනය හෙවත් සෙනෙහසක සිහිනය; lit. ' Dream of Love '), is a 2021 Sri Lankan Sinhala drama thriller film directed and produced by Nihal Sanjaya with the help of Anton Kingsley and Irfan Senudeen who were the previous co-director and producer respectively. Kadawunu Poronduwa was produced by S. M. Nayagam, [1] a pioneer of Sinhala film industry and an Indian citizen. He had to ferry the entire cast to Madurai India for filming and production. It began as a successful play for dramatist B. A. W. Jayamanne. In 1947 he filmed and processed the movie in South India. [2]
Dharmayuddhaya (Sinhalese: ධර්මයුද්ධය ; transl. War for Justice) is a 2017 Sri Lankan Sinhala-language crime thriller film directed by Cheyyar Ravi and produced by MTV Channel and The Capital Maharaja Organization Limited, and distributed by M Entertainments.
